    Supplement the first floor: the third officer is a senior seafarer, and now the senior seafarer is generally signed by the company first, and then the company entrusts you to go to school to study, but you have to pay the company's certificate training fee, generally about 6,000, you can also be a free crew, do not sign the company directly to go to the school to study, and find an internship in the company after graduation. The two-year tuition fee is about 25,000, which can be paid in two years.

    During the school period, students will study for four minor certificates, seven major certificates and various assessments, including nautical English listening and speaking. Unified invigilation of the State Maritime Administration, seven courses: Navigation English, Ship Collision Avoidance, Cargo Transportation, Ship Structure, Management, Meteorology, Navigation, and various assessment exams, Radar Certificate, GMDSS Communication, etc.

    All seven major certificates are multiple-choice questions, and the 100-point test paper is 70 points passed. Since graduation, you can take the make-up examination for three years, basically three make-up opportunities every year, with an average one-time pass rate of 30%, which has little to do with high school knowledge, is relatively abstract, as long as you work hard, you can pass all.     Ordinary crew refers to the sailor on duty, the crew on duty mechanic and other positions, according to the current regulations, ordinary crew members are not allowed to participate in the examination of senior crew if they do not have a college degree or above in relevant majors (colleges and universities recognized by the Ministry of Communications). (There is no academic requirement for officers in the inshore navigation area); Because of the low entry threshold for ordinary seafarers, they can get on board after more than three months of short-term training. The wages of the crew are much higher than the wages on land, so many people have participated in the training and obtained the certificate of competency of sailors and mechanics on duty.

    Officers refer to the captain, first officer, second officer, third officer, chief engineer, chief engineer, second engineer, and third engineer. The ways to become an officer are: to participate in the officer training courses offered by various maritime colleges, especially the famous maritime universities, such as Wuhan University of Technology, Dalian Maritime University, Shanghai Maritime University, Jimei University, Guangdong Ocean University and other universities, which generally require 2 or 4 years of study; Participate in the training bases for senior seafarers run by various shipping companies, such as COSCO and CSCL.

    According to the characteristics of the division of labor among the crew, the cargo ship is divided into the deck department, the engine department and the affairs department, the chief officer, the chief engineer and the chief of affairs are respectively the department chiefs, and the passenger ship is the department of affairs under the passenger department, and the director of passenger transportation is the department head. The captain is the leader of the ship and has the primary and full responsibility for driving the ship and managing the ship.

    Function introduction: 1. The third deputy is in charge of ship lifesaving and fire-fighting equipment. Under the leadership of the captain and chief officer, conscientiously implement the provisions of the company's comprehensive management system, and perform the prescribed duties of ship navigation and berthing watch.

    2. Should be familiar with and abide by the watch, contact system, as well as navigation safety, technical operation regulations. During loading and unloading, the loading and unloading of goods is managed according to the arrangement of the chief officer.

    3. Manage the ship's fire-fighting equipment, equipment and fire alarm equipment, and regularly maintain, inspect and change the dressing to keep it in good technical condition; The fire extinguisher should indicate the date of inspection and change of the resistance to the fire extinguisher. <>

    Summary. Hello, strictly speaking, there are 8 officers in total. Captain, first mate, second officer, third officer, chief engineer (old rail), chief engineer (second track), second engineer (third track), third engineer (four track); There are also commissars on the ships of large domestic companies.

    The white third officer and the third engineer are only interns, and although the driving assistant and the rotation assistant have certificates, these positions are dispensable, and there is no specific division of responsibilities, so they are not formal officers; Electricians are no longer required to be certified, nor are they mandatory, and they are recognized as electricians in large foreign companies, and it is just a convention to say that he is an officer; The boatswain is the highest rank among ordinary sailors, let alone officers! Generally, on cargo ships, there is only one person for each position; However, on passenger ships, luxury cruise ships and some special ships, there may be more than one person in one position due to the need for their own work. For example, in luxury cruise ships, there are chief captains and sailing captains, and on special ships, there are deck three engineers, and so on.

    Third officer, third engineer competency examination subjects and evaluation items:

    The three management theory examination subjects are: marine engineering foundation, main propulsion power plant, ship auxiliary engine, marine English, ship electrical, marine maintenance and repair, ship management and other seven subjects.

    The three-pipe evaluation items are: marine English listening and speaking, power equipment disassembly and assembly, power equipment operation, metalworking technology, ship electrical technology and electrical testing, and ship power station operation. (
